Bible Verse Review
from Treasury of Scripure Knowledge
Etam: Ether, or Etham, was situated near Malatha, according to Eusebius. Joshua 19:7, Ether, Remmon
Ashan: Eusebius say Beth-ashan was sixteen miles west of Jerusalem.
Reciprocal: Judges 15:11 - the rock Etam 1 Chronicles 6:59 - Ashan 2 Chronicles 11:6 - Etam Zechariah 14:10 - Rimmon
Gill's Notes on the Bible
And their villages were Etam, and Ain, Rimmon, and Tochen, and Ashan, five cities. There are but four mentioned in
Joshua 19:7 one might be added since, or new built, namely, Tochen; these, according to Kimchi, were all that remained for them to dwell in, in the times of David; and therefore they were obliged to seek out for new settlements for themselves and flocks, as in 1 Chronicles 4:39, &c.
